Understanding the Emotional Impact of Downsizing

Retirement marks a significant life transition, and downsizing your home can bring feelings of loss, nostalgia, and anxiety. Recognizing these emotions helps you navigate the change with grace.

Practical Tips for Successful Downsizing

  • Plan Early: Start sorting belongings months ahead to avoid last-minute stress.
  • Prioritize Essentials: Keep items that add value or joy, and consider donating or selling others.
  • Choose the Right Space: Find a home that fits your current lifestyle and future needs.
  • Enlist Help: Use family, friends, or professional organizers to ease the process.

Financial Considerations for Retirees

Downsizing can free up equity and reduce expenses, but it’s important to understand associated costs like moving fees, taxes, and potential renovations.

Maintaining Connection and Comfort in Your New Home

Personalize your new space with meaningful decor and maintain ties with your community to make the transition feel like home.
